twitter引导图标未按预期显示,而不是字符

时间:2013-07-16 15:37:19

标签: html5 twitter-bootstrap character-encoding icons font-awesome

早上好,

我开始使用twitter-bootstrap和font-awesome框架开发第一个html项目。我已经在页面中包含了两个资源而没有任何问题。但是,当我尝试使用<i class="icon-wrench intro-icon-large"></i>图标时,它没有显示,而是打印出一个符号:

icons error encoding

如果我用firebug检查元素,我看到html ok,但是在font-awesome.ss中我看到了:

.icon-wrench:before {
    content: "";
}

但是,如果我从编辑器打开css文件,我会看到:

.icon-wrench:before{content:"\f0ad"}

这种行为使我感到困惑,因为所有资源都是根据指​​定的路径正确加载的,并且图标图像也在那里。

另外一个事实是,每个图标都会发生这种情况,包括本机引导图标。

2 个答案:

答案 0 :(得分:2)

Firefox似乎与Font-Awesome有一些问题...

  

使用Font Awesome时我发现在Firefox中,字符不会呈现为

以下是“潜在”修复:Font Awesome not working in Firefox (possible fix found)

答案 1 :(得分:1)

您可以使用CDN。只需加入

<link href="//netdna.bootstrapcdn.com/font-awesome/4.0.3/css/font-awesome.css" rel="stylesheet">
<{1>}部分中的